The Rise of AI Investments
In recent months, the investment landscape has been significantly influenced by advancements in artificial intelligence. Cathie Wood, the renowned CEO of ARK Invest, is at the forefront of this trend, strategically positioning her firm to capitalize on the burgeoning AI sector. ARK Invest’s recent moves indicate a clear focus on companies that provide essential tools and technologies for AI, often referred to as ‘picks-and-shovels’ in the investment community. This approach not only mitigates risk but also aligns with the growing trend of digital transformation across various industries.

Strategic Investments in AI
ARK's approach involves identifying and investing in companies that not only create AI technologies but also those that support its development. This includes hardware manufacturers, software developers, and infrastructure providers. By focusing on the 'picks and shovels' of the AI industry, ARK Invest is preparing for a future where AI is ubiquitous and integral to everyday operations.
Benefits of the Picks-and-Shovels Approach
- Lower volatility compared to direct AI technology investments.
- Access to a broader range of investment opportunities.
- Long-term growth potential as AI integrates deeper into various sectors.
- Alignment with global adoption trends, particularly in tech-savvy regions.
